Foundation and Brief History
University of Basrah for Oil and Gas was established during the academic year (2013–2014) with the inauguration of the College of Oil and Gas Engineering, which initially included two specialized scientific departments: the Department of Oil and Gas Engineering and the Department of Chemical Engineering and Petroleum Refining. In its first academic year, the college welcomed (152) students from high school science graduates, making it the first specialized Iraqi university in the fields of oil, gas, and energy.
As part of its strategic plan for academic expansion and to meet the needs of the energy sector, the university witnessed a new phase of development in the academic year (2017–2018) marked by the establishment of the College of Industrial Management for Oil and Gas, comprising the following scientific departments: Department of Oil and Gas Management and Marketing, Department of Oil and Gas Economics, and Department of Petroleum Projects Management.
During the same academic year, the Department of Polymers and Petrochemicals Engineering was established as the third scientific department in the College of Oil and Gas Engineering, supporting modern engineering specialties related to petroleum and petrochemical industries.
Continuing its academic development path, the academic year (2025–2026) witnessed the establishment of the Department of Petroleum Accounting, becoming the fourth scientific department in the College of Industrial Management for Oil and Gas, thereby enhancing integration between engineering, administrative, and financial specialties required by the oil and gas sector.
As part of updating and developing academic programs to align with scientific advancements and labor market needs, the name of the Department of Polymers and Petrochemicals Engineering in the College of Oil and Gas Engineering was changed during the academic year (2025–2026) to the Department of Gas Processing and Petrochemicals Engineering, reflecting the evolution in the nature and modern scientific directions of the specialization.
Since its inception, the university has prioritized building a rigorous academic and research system based on quality standards and academic accreditation, working to strengthen cooperation with local, regional, and international universities and scientific institutions to exchange expertise, transfer modern knowledge and technology, and develop scientific research and innovation.
The university also strives to prepare qualified scientific, engineering, and administrative cadres possessing the efficiency, knowledge, and skills required to keep pace with rapid developments in the energy sector and contribute to achieving sustainable development goals in Iraq. University graduates have proven their distinguished presence in state institutions and the public and private sectors, particularly in the oil and gas industry, forming a vital pillar in supporting national industry and economic development in line with the university's vision of achieving integration between engineering and administrative disciplines to serve the future of the energy sector.

University Colleges and Departments
The University of Basrah for Oil and Gas includes two specialized colleges offering qualitative academic programs in engineering and administrative fields related to the oil and gas sector:
First: College of Oil and Gas Engineering
The College of Oil and Gas Engineering is the first specialized Iraqi government college in this field. It offers academic programs aimed at preparing qualified engineers equipped with the scientific knowledge and practical skills necessary to meet the needs of the oil and gas sector.
Department of Oil and Gas Engineering
Focuses on oil and gas exploration and production, reservoir engineering, well drilling, production techniques, and oil field management.
Department of Chemical Engineering and Petroleum Refining
Focuses on petroleum refining processes, natural gas processing, and the design and operation of refining units and industrial processes.
Department of Gas Processing and Petrochemicals Engineering
Focuses on natural gas processing techniques, petrochemical industries, and operations related to the production of polymeric materials and chemical products.
Second: College of Industrial Management for Oil and Gas
The college offers specialized academic programs combining administrative sciences with the requirements of the oil and gas industry, aiming to prepare personnel capable of managing institutions and projects in the energy sector efficiently and effectively.
Department of Oil and Gas Management and Marketing
Focuses on the management of oil and gas production and marketing operations, energy market analysis, and the development of marketing strategies.
Department of Oil and Gas Economics
Focuses on energy economics, petroleum investment, and economic policies related to the oil and gas sector.
Department of Petroleum Projects Management
Focuses on the planning, management, implementation, and evaluation of petroleum and engineering projects according to modern professional practices.
Department of Petroleum Accounting
Focuses on accounting and financial systems applied in oil and gas companies and institutions, preparing specialized competencies in petroleum accounting.
